Saint-Jerome is the start (or end) of the Petite Train du...

Saint-Jerome is the start (or end) of the Petite Train du Nord cycle route. Excellent cycle infrastructure. Plenty of restaurants in the downtown core. A lively place for events. We stayed at the Super 8 which is about 4 kms from the downtown core, but there were restaurants close by. Getting to the Super 8 on bicycles was not quite as straight forward as we would have liked, but leaving to join the Petite Nord du Train south was easy as we knew where the cycle paths were.
